Clinical Research Of Mini-Skin Graft Covered With Acellular Xenogenic Dermal In Treating The Large Area Skin Defects

Objective To explore the possibility and clinical effect of autologous mini-skin graft covered with acellular xenogenic dermal in treatment of large area skin defects.Methods 24 cases of extensive deep burn and 6 cases of large area skin avulsion are selected in my department from November 2006 to December 2010. When condition is stable,they are given escharectomy (tangential excision) or excision of skin avulsion,and all are transplanted the mini-skin graft ,which then covered with acellular xenogenic dermal. Postoperative observation: the rejection of acellular xenogenic dermal;wound exudation; time for wound healing;follow-up from 3 months to 2 years after healing to observe the appearance and flexibility .Results After 5 days of the operation, wound exudation obviously decreased; after 21 days the acellular xenogenic dermal gradually deactivated and exfoliated in dry scabs. There is no redness or rashes surrounding the wounds. The healing time for the large area deep burn was from 16 to 40 (23.04±6.56)days and large area avulsion skin injuries was from 18 to 35 (24.67 ±5.92)days. Follow-up for15 cases from 3 to 6 months after healing showed good epithelialization and pigmentation.There were superficial scars which showed slightly stiff and mild contracture. Follow-up for 8 cases from 1 to 2 years showed no obvious scars proliferation, little pigmentation,better recovery of flexibility and functonality and no contracture deformity.Conclusion Acellular xenogeneic dermal as a covering in treating large area skin defects by mini-skin graft can effectively reduce wound exudation , help to facilitate healing, alleviate the patients'pain and reduce scar formation.It is worth of clinical promotion and application.
